The Role of AI in Project Management
AI in project management focuses on analysing vast amounts of data, recognising patterns, and predicting outcomes. It brings automation to repetitive tasks and enhances the ability to forecast project performance. AI systems can process historical data, detect potential risks, and recommend solutions, enabling managers to anticipate challenges before they arise.
For example, AI can predict project delays by analysing previous project timelines and identifying bottlenecks. It can recommend solutions like redistributing workloads or reallocating resources to keep the project on track. How AI Predicts Project Outcomes
AI tools leverage machine learning and predictive analytics to assess multiple variables. These variables include deadlines, resource availability, budget constraints, and potential risks. The data collected from past and ongoing projects feeds into machine learning algorithms, which then forecast outcomes with remarkable accuracy.
For instance, AI can answer questions like:
- What is the likelihood of the project finishing on time?
- Will the project stay within budget?
- Are there risks that could impact delivery timelines?

Benefits of AI in Predicting Project Outcomes
Here are some of the key benefits that AI offers in predicting project outcomes.
Improved Accuracy
One of AI’s biggest advantages is its ability to provide accurate predictions. Traditional methods rely heavily on estimations, leaving room for errors. AI eliminates this by processing large datasets and drawing precise conclusions.
Better Risk Management
AI tools can identify risks early in the project lifecycle, enabling teams to address them before they escalate. Whether it’s resource shortages or external factors like supply chain disruptions, AI predictions offer actionable risk mitigation strategies.
Optimised Resource Allocation
Managing resources is a critical task in any project. AI ensures that workloads are distributed evenly and that team members are not overburdened. It predicts areas of inefficiency and offers recommendations to optimise performance. Professionals need extensive hands-on training to handle these tasks efficiently.
Cost Savings
Predictive analytics help managers identify where resources and budgets are being overutilised. AI forecasts allow teams to cut unnecessary expenses and improve overall financial planning.
Enhanced Decision-Making
AI delivers insights based on real-time data, allowing project managers to make informed decisions quickly. By predicting potential roadblocks, managers can prioritise tasks and allocate resources where they’re needed most.
AI Tools for Project Management
Several AI-driven tools are currently transforming project management. Platforms like Microsoft Project, Monday.com, and Asana now incorporate AI to improve workflows and predict outcomes. These tools analyse project timelines, track productivity, and provide performance forecasts. AI algorithms can suggest task priorities and even highlight risks before they affect the project.
For example, an AI-based project management tool might alert a manager that a project phase is likely to miss its deadline based on the team’s current progress. Overcoming Challenges of AI in Project Management
Despite its advantages, implementing AI in project management isn’t without challenges. The most common issues include:
- Data Quality: AI relies on high-quality data to make accurate predictions. Incomplete, inconsistent, and or inaccurate data can lead to unreliable outcomes.
- Integration with Existing Systems: Many organisations struggle to integrate AI tools with legacy project management systems.
- Skill Gaps: AI tools require project managers to develop technical skills to understand and use predictive insights effectively.
To overcome these challenges, companies must invest in training teams to work with AI tools and ensure data accuracy. Future of AI in Project Management
AI is rapidly evolving and becoming an indispensable part of project management. In the future, AI is expected to play a larger role in automating decision-making, resource planning, and risk assessment. Advanced AI tools will incorporate natural language processing (NLP) to analyse project updates and communications in real-time, providing even deeper insights.
Moreover, AI-driven tools will soon integrate predictive simulations, allowing managers to test different scenarios and visualise outcomes, which eliminates any guesswork and subjective inferences. This level of fact-based foresight will empower managers to choose the best strategies for project success.
